Rangers Hang On for Second Straight Win

Box Score

The Basics
Score: East Central 66  - Northwestern 71 
Records: East Central 12-5 (8-3 GAC) - Northwestern 5-10 (5-6 GAC)
Location: Percefull Fieldhouse - Alva, Okla. 

ALVA, Okla. -  After a near wire-to-wire win, Northwestern Oklahoma State was able to take home their second straight victory, this time against East Central, who is currently sitting sixth in the Central Region Poll and was also tops in the GAC before the contest this afternoon.

Individual Leaders
  • After a rough start, Adrian Motley turned up his game in the second, ending the night with a double-double, recording 17 points and 12 boards.
  • Laakeem Henderson had an effective evening as he posted a 12-point game, including going 3-for-4 from the charity stripe.
  • Continuing his great streak, Zachary Dumas has now scored in double figures in five of the last six games, including an 11-point performance against the Tigers.
  • Two other Rangers also posted double-digit numbers on offense with Brandon Green and Deiondray Martin both putting up 10. Green also had six boards and five helpers.
Game Changer
  • Over a three minute period, the Rangers went on a big 11-point run to take a 21-10 lead. The run ultimately set the pace in the first half.
  • To end the half, Northwestern went on a 9-2 run to take a commanding 16-point advantage.
  • East Central went on a couple big runs to bring the game back to within range and even took a one-point lead with 2:09 left to play.
  • The last eight Ranger points were off free throws, willing them to a five-point win.

News and Notes
  • Motley has been on fire from the charity stripe over the last several games as he has currently hit 25-straight free shots.
  • The Rangers win over the Tigers gave the Black-and-Red a two-game winstreak, the first of the season.

Up Next
  • Northwestern Oklahoma State Men's basketball will take the road next week to Arkansas when they will travel to Harding on Thursday, Jan. 28, after which they will play at Arkansas Tech on the 30th.
